WW Integrated Marketing Systems and Integrated Systems Tech (WIMSI Tech) serves as the backbone for how Amazon designs, measures, and optimizes marketing worldwide. Our mission is to deliver scalable, reliable, and intelligent marketing technology that empowers teams across Amazon to create customer‑centric campaigns with speed, precision, and global reach.
Our cross‑functional organization spans product, engineering, and science teams, building solutions that integrate data, automation, and AI into marketing workflows. From advanced experimentation and measurement platforms, to tools for campaign creation, targeting, and performance optimization, WIMSI Tech drives innovation that powers Amazon's marketing engine. As part of a global Amazon organization, we combine the agility of a startup with the resources and scope of one of the world's leading technology companies. Our products enable marketers to reach millions of customers worldwide, with experiences that are personalized, measurable, and built to scale.
